Summary
Deep vein thrombosis (DVT) is a condition where blood clots form in deep veins. This article explains DVT causes, prevention, and treatments including anticoagulant medications and nursing care.

Main Methods:
- Review of risk factors, pathophysiology, prevention, and detection of DVT.
- Discussion of key anticoagulant medications: unfractionated heparin (UFH), low molecular weight heparin (enoxaparin), and warfarin.
- Examination of nursing assessment, monitoring, and patient education strategies.
Main Results:
- DVT involves clot formation in deep veins, influenced by various risk factors.
- Effective prevention and early detection are vital for patient outcomes.
- Anticoagulants like UFH, enoxaparin, and warfarin are primary treatment modalities.
- Nursing plays a critical role in patient monitoring and education for safe anticoagulant use.
